From google:

Employment Protections: Pennsylvania has some of the strongest workplace protections for patients in the country, though they are not absolute. • Anti-Discrimination: Employers cannot fire, refuse to hire, or retaliate against you solely because you are a medical marijuana patient.  • Unemployment Benefits: Courts have ruled that if you are fired for a positive drug test but have a valid MMJ card, you are generally still eligible for unemployment benefits.  • The "Safety-Sensitive" Exception: This is the big loophole. Employers can still restrict you from "safety-sensitive" roles (like operating heavy machinery, working with high-voltage electricity, or working at great heights) if they believe your use poses a risk.  • Federal Jobs & CDL: If your job is governed by federal law (e.g., DOT/CDL drivers, federal contractors), the state card does not protect you. Federal law still views marijuana as a controlled substance.
